Transaction 58ec7c2434e1f01148971cfd5d1101fa73f50e72a30d49fffafa234e7f498648
2 Input
2 Outputs
- 58ec7c2434e1f01148971cfd5d1101fa73f50e72a30d49fffafa234e7f498648:0
- 58ec7c2434e1f01148971cfd5d1101fa73f50e72a30d49fffafa234e7f498648:1
value 776435
address 1C5tngd6DyqysuP1sFypVJqfcQP6Bz31UR
value 20105539
address 33eY41u7MDQqd9Y8kDj9NqmU3iAvHSnHwp